换码指令XLAT要求给出存储单元的有效地址为()。A、(BX)+(AL)B、(BX)+(AX)C、(BX)D、(AL)

题目

换码指令XLAT要求给出存储单元的有效地址为()。

  • A、(BX)+(AL)
  • B、(BX)+(AX)
  • C、(BX)
  • D、(AL)

相似考题
更多“换码指令XLAT要求给出存储单元的有效地址为()。”相关问题
  • 第1题:

    2013网络工程师考试试题

    计算机指令一般包括操作码和地址码两部分,为分析执行一条指令,其  1      

    A 操作码应存入指令寄存器(IR),地址码应存入程序计数器(PC)   

    B 操作码应存入程序计数器(PC),地址码应存入指令寄存器(IR)。  

    C 操作码和地址码都应存入指令寄存器。   

    D 操作码和地址码都应存入程序计数器

    求解析。


    答案:(1)C    

    试题解析:   

     指令寄存器(IR)用来保存当前正在执行的一条指令。当执行一条指令时,先把它从内存取到数据寄存器(DR)中,然后再传送至IR。指令划分为操作码和地址码字段,由二进制数字组成。为了执行任何给定的指令,必须对操作码进行测试,以便识别所要求的操作。指令译码器就是做这项工作的。指令寄存器中操作码字段的输出就是指令译码器的输入。操作码一经译码后,即可向操作控制器发出具体操作的特定信号。

  • 第2题:

    计算机指令的操作码是用来( )。

    A.规定指令进行的操作种类

    B.给出操作数地址

    C.给出结果地址

    D.给出下一条指令的地址


    参考答案:A

  • 第3题:

    换码指令XLAT完成的操作是【 】。它经常用于把一种代码转换为另一种代码。如果执行此操作,应首先建立一个字节表格,但表格的长度不能超过256个字节。


    正确答案:(AL)←((CBX)+(AL))
    (AL)←((CBX)+(AL))

  • 第4题:

    目前,一般计算机系统中的主存储器容量都很大,而且越来越大。另外,由于普遍采用了虚拟存储器结构,要求指令中给出的地址码是一个虚拟地址,其长度比实际主存储器的容量所要求的长度还要长得多。例如,在一般32位计算机系统中,虚拟地址空间为4GB,因此,要求地址码的长度为32位左右。如此长的地址码对于多地址结构的指令系统是无法容忍的。因此,如何缩短地址码的长度,在指令系统中必须予以考虑。下面关于缩短地址码长度的方法正确的是(1)。

    Ⅰ.用主存间接寻址方式缩短地址码长度

    Ⅱ.用变址寻址方式缩短地址码长度

    Ⅲ.用寄存器间接寻址方式缩短地址码长度

    A.Ⅰ.Ⅱ.

    B.Ⅰ.Ⅱ.Ⅲ.

    C.Ⅱ.Ⅲ.

    D.Ⅰ.Ⅲ.


    正确答案:B
    解析:用主存间接寻址方式缩短地址码长度。在主存储器的低端地址开辟出一个专门用来存放地址的区域,由于表示存储器低端地址所需要的地址码长度可以很短,而一个存储字(一次访问存储器所能获得的数据)的长度通常与一个逻辑地址码的长度相当。如果一个存储字的长度短于一个逻辑地址的长度,也可以用几个连续的存储字来存放一个逻辑地址码。例如,在主存储器最低端的1KB之内有一个用来存放地址码的区域,如果主存储器是按字节编址的,并且一个存储字的长度为32位,那么在指令中只要用8位(256个字=1K字节)长度就能表示一个32位长的逻辑地址,即使再加上寻址方式等信息,一个地址码的长度也只有十多位。用变址寻址方式缩短地址码长度。由于程序的局部性,在变址寻址方式中使用的地址偏移量可以比较短,例如,在IBM370系列机中为12位。通常可以把比较长的基地址(如32位)放在变址寄存器中,在指令的地址码中只需给出比较短的地址偏移量。因此,采用变址寻址方式的地址码长度通常只有十几位,或二十位左右就可以了。用寄存器间接寻址方式缩短地址码长度。这是一种非常有效的方法。由于寄存器的数量比较少,通常表示一个寄存器的地址只需要很少几位,而一个寄存器的字长足可以放下一个逻辑地址。例如,有8个用于间接寻址的寄存器,每个寄存器的长度是32位,这样,用一个3位的地址码就能表示一个32位的逻辑地址。用来支持间接寻址的寄存器,可以借用通用寄存器,也可专门设置。

  • 第5题:

    计算机指令一般包括操作码和地址码两部分,为分析执行一条命令,其()。

    A.操作码应存入指令寄存器(IR),地址码应存入程序计数器(PC)
    B.操作码应存入程序计数器(PC),地址码应存入指令寄存器(IR)
    C.操作码和地址码都应存入指令寄存器
    D.操作码和地址码都应存入程序计数器

    答案:C
    解析:
    指令寄存器(IR)用来保存当前正在执行的一条指令。当执行一条指令时,先把它从内存取到数据寄存器(DR)中,然后再传送至IR。指令划分为操作码和地址码字段,由二进制数字组成。为了执行任何给定的指令,必须对操作码进行测试,以便识别所要求的操作。指令译码器就是做这项工作的。指令寄存器中操作码字段的输出就是指令译码器的输入。操作码一经译码后,即可向操作控制器发出具体操作的特定信号。

  • 第6题:

    指令MOV DX,COUNT[BP][DI]的执行结果是()。

    • A、将COUNT的值传送给DX
    • B、将COUNT+BP+DI的值传送给DX
    • C、将数据段中有效地址为COUNT+BP+DI的存储单元的值传送给DX
    • D、将堆栈段中有效地址为COUNT+BP+DI的存储单元的值传送给DX

    正确答案:D

  • 第7题:

    使用换码指令时,要求()寄存器指向表的首地址,而()寄存器中为表中某一项与表格首地址之间的偏移量。

    • A、AX,AL
    • B、BX,AL
    • C、BX,BL
    • D、AX,BL

    正确答案:B

  • 第8题:

    间接寻址是指()。

    • A、指令中直接给出操作数地址
    • B、指令中直接给出操作数
    • C、指令中间接给出操作数
    • D、指令中间接给出操作数地址

    正确答案:D

  • 第9题:

    用指令MOV BX,SEG COUNT指令,可以得到存储单元COUNT的()。

    • A、物理地址
    • B、段地址
    • C、偏移地址
    • D、属性

    正确答案:B

  • 第10题:

    单选题
    指令MOV DX,COUNT[BP][DI]的执行结果是()。
    A

    将COUNT的值传送给DX

    B

    将COUNT+BP+DI的值传送给DX

    C

    将数据段中有效地址为COUNT+BP+DI的存储单元的值传送给DX

    D

    将堆栈段中有效地址为COUNT+BP+DI的存储单元的值传送给DX


    正确答案: C
    解析: 暂无解析

  • 第11题:

    单选题
    计算机指令中规定操作对象的内容或所在的存储单元地址的部分称为()。
    A

    被操作数

    B

    操作数

    C

    地址对象

    D

    操作码


    正确答案: B
    解析: 暂无解析

  • 第12题:

    单选题
    存储器中可以存储指令,也可以存储数据,计算机靠()来判别。
    A

    最高位为1还是0

    B

    ASCII码

    C

    存储单元的地址

    D

    CPU执行程序的过程


    正确答案: C
    解析: 暂无解析

  • 第13题:

    执行指令时,操作数存放在内存单元中,指令中给出操作数所在存储单元地址的寻址方式称为(2)。

    A.立即寻址

    B.直接寻址

    C.相对寻址

    D.寄存器寻址


    正确答案:B
    解析:寻址方式是指如何对指令中的地址字段进行解释,以获得操作数据的方法或获得程序转移地址的方法。常见的寻址方式有立即寻址、直接寻址、间接寻址、寄存器寻址、寄存器间接寻址、相对寻址和变址寻址等。各种寻址方式操作数存放位置见表3-4。

     执行指令时,操作数存放在内存单元中,指令中给出操作数所在存储单元地址的寻址方式称为直接寻址。

  • 第14题:

    换码指令XLAT完成的操作是______。它经常用于把一种代码转换为另+种代码。如果执行此操作,应首先建立一个字节表格,但表格的长度不能超过______。


    正确答案:(AL)←((CBX)+(AL))    256个字节
    (AL)←((CBX)+(AL))  ,  256个字节

  • 第15题:

    指令XLAT通常用于查表操作,在使用该指令前,应把有的偏移首地址送入( )。

    A.DI

    B.BX

    C.CX

    D.SI


    正确答案:B

  • 第16题:

    如果在指令的地址码部分给出的是操作数地址的地址,这种寻址方式称为(10)。在指令执行结束时,CPU中的指令指针寄存器存放(11)。

    A.直接寻址

    B.间接寻址

    C.相对寻址

    D.变址寻址


    正确答案:B

  • 第17题:

    换码指令XLAT要求给出存储单元的有效地址为()。

    • A、(BX)+(AL)
    • B、(BX)+(AX)
    • C、(BX)
    • D、(AL)

    正确答案:A

  • 第18题:

    计算机指令中,规定该指令执行功能的部分称为()。

    • A、数据码
    • B、操作码
    • C、源地址码
    • D、目标地址

    正确答案:B

  • 第19题:

    计算机指令中规定操作对象的内容或所在的存储单元地址的部分称为()。

    • A、被操作数
    • B、操作数
    • C、地址对象
    • D、操作码

    正确答案:B

  • 第20题:

    指令中地址码字段中直接提供存储单元存放操作数的有效地址,则它是()寻址方式。

    • A、间接
    • B、立即
    • C、寄存器
    • D、直接

    正确答案:A

  • 第21题:

    单选题
    换码指令XLAT要求给出存储单元的有效地址为()。
    A

    (BX)+(AL)

    B

    (BX)+(AX)

    C

    (BX)

    D

    (AL)


    正确答案: B
    解析: 暂无解析

  • 第22题:

    单选题
    用指令MOV BX,SEG COUNT指令,可以得到存储单元COUNT的()。
    A

    物理地址

    B

    段地址

    C

    偏移地址

    D

    属性


    正确答案: A
    解析: 暂无解析

  • 第23题:

    单选题
    在存贮器读周期时,根据指令指针IP提供的有效地址,使用从内存中取出(  )。
    A

    操作数

    B

    操作数地址

    C

    转移地址

    D

    指令码


    正确答案: D
    解析:

  • 第24题:

    单选题
    指令中地址码字段中直接提供存储单元存放操作数的有效地址,则它是()寻址方式。
    A

    间接

    B

    立即

    C

    寄存器

    D

    直接


    正确答案: B
    解析: 暂无解析